Official abstract text for this publication.
The present disclosure relates to a head mounted display comprising: a body mounted on a user's facial region and including a display for providing image information; and a wearable member configured to support the body and be mounted on the user's head, wherein the wearable member comprises: a front band part formed to have a rounded shape so as to be stably placed on the front of the user's head; hinge members supporting both ends of the body and allowing the body to be pivoted upward/downward or slid forward/backward; and a rear band part formed to surround the back of the user's head, fixed to both sides of the front band part, and configured to support the hinge members when the hinge members move.

The invention claimed is: 1. A Head Mounted Display (HMD) comprising: a body mounted on a user's facial region and including a display for providing image information; and a wearable member configured to support the body and be mounted on the user's head, wherein the wearable member comprises: a front band part formed to have a rounded shape so as to be stably placed on the front of the user's head; hinge members supporting both ends of the body and allowing the body to be pivoted upward/downward and slid forward/backward; and a rear band part formed to surround the back of the user's head, fixed to both sides of the front band part, and configured to support the hinge members when the hinge members move, wherein the hinge member comprises: a first member having a first through hole formed through a central portion thereof, and having one side coupled to the body to be rotatable; a second member having a second through hole formed through a central portion thereof to correspond to the first through hole, and having rotation limiting portions protruded from one surface of the second member; a support shaft disposed to pass through the first through hole and the second through hole; and a third member formed in a plate-like shape and fixed to the support shaft, wherein a rotation of the first member is limited by the rotation limiting portions and a rotation of the second member is limited by the second through hole. 2. The head mounted display of claim 1 , wherein the rear band part comprises: a rear band extending to have a predetermined length so as to be tightened on the rear of the user's head; slide rails located to surround an outer surface of the rear band, and configured to move along the outer surface of the rear band when the hinge members slide; and a rear band cover coupled to the rear band so that an inner surface thereof is located on outer sides of the slide rails. 3. The head mounted display of claim 2 , wherein the rear band cover is provided on the inner surface thereof with a slide rail guide groove extending by a predetermined depth along a direction that the rear band cover extends, and wherein the slide rails slide with being supported by the slide rail guide groove. 4. The head mounted display of claim 3 , wherein the rear band part is provided with a support bracket inserted into the rear band cover to support the slide rails located in the slide rail guide groove. 5. The head mounted display of claim 2 , wherein the hinge members comprise a first hinge member supporting one end portion of the body and a second hinge member supporting another end portion of the body, and wherein the slide rails comprise a first slide rail coupled to the first hinge member, and a second slide rail coupled to the second hinge member and extending toward the first slide rail. 6. The head mounted display of claim 5 , wherein the first slide rail is provided with a first gear portion formed downward on one end portion thereof, wherein the second slide rail is provided with a second gear portion formed upward on one end portion thereof to face the first gear portion, and wherein the first gear portion and the second gear portion are brought into contact with a rotation gear to allow relative movement of the first and second slide rails. 7. The head mounted display of claim 6 , wherein the first gear portion and the second gear portion rotate with being engaged with the rotation gear, in response to the forward and backward sliding of the hinge members, so that the first slide rail and the second slide rail move forward and backward along the slide rail guide groove. 8. The head mounted display of claim 6 , wherein the rear band cover is provided with a rotation gear accommodation protrusion protruding toward the rear band so that the rotation gear is inserted therein. 9. The head mounted display of claim 8 , wherein a rotation limiting member is inserted into the rotation gear accommodation protrusion to limit the rotation of the rotation gear. 10. The head mounted display of claim 1 , wherein the wearable member further comprises: a base portion coupled to the front band part and having a shape corresponding to the front of the user's head; and a cushion portion coupled to the base portion and configured to absorb shock. 11. The head mounted display of claim 1 , wherein the front band part comprises front band rails disposed on both ends thereof, wherein the front band part comprises a front band adjustment portion configured to move the front band rails to be tightened on the user's head, and wherein the front band adjustment portion implements the movement of the front band rails by applying a predetermined tensile force to the front band rails while supporting the front band rails. 12. The head mounted display of claim 11 , wherein the front band adjustment portion comprises a dial member supporting the respective front band rails, and wherein the dial member comprises: a holder formed in a cylindrical shape having an opening at one end thereof, and provided with an insertion hole formed through a central portion thereof so that a guide pin is inserted, and a gear support groove formed along an inner circumferential surface thereof; a main dial disposed to cover the opening and configured to be rotated by a user in one direction; a first gear coupled to the guide pin, engaged with the gear support groove, and configured to rotate while an outer surface thereof is brought into contact with the gear support groove when the main dial is rotated; and a second gear fixed to one end of the guide pin, allowing the movement of the front band rails in response to the rotation of the first gear, and configured to apply the predetermined tensile force to the front band rails. 13. The head mounted display of claim 12 , wherein the gear support groove is provided with a thread formed in one direction to allow the rotation of the first gear only in the one direction. 14. The head mounted display of claim 13 , wherein the front band rails, when the main dial is rotated by a preset angle, move to right and left by a distance corresponding to the rotation. 15. The head mounted display of claim 12 , wherein the first gear is separated from the gear support groove when the main dial is pushed, so that the tensile force applied to the front band rails by the second gear is removed. 16. The head mounted display of claim 1 , wherein a sliding distance of a support portion of the first member is limited by the rotation limiting portions, and wherein an angle at which the first member is rotatable centering on the support shaft is limited in an upward or downward direction.
